Detection of BRAF mutations in patients with hairy cell leukemia and related lymphoproliferative disorders.

Abstract

Hairy cell leukemia has been shown to be strongly associated with the BRAF V600E mutation. We screened 59 unenriched archived bone marrow aspirate and peripheral blood samples from 51 patients with hairy cell leukemia using high resolution melting analysis and confirmatory Sanger sequencing. The BRAF V600E mutation was detected in 38 samples (from 36 patients). The BRAF V600E mutation was detected in all samples with disease involvement above the limit of sensitivity of the techniques used. Thirty-three of 34 samples from other hematologic malignancies were negative for BRAF mutations. A BRAF K601E mutation was detected in a patient with splenic marginal zone lymphoma. Our data support the recent finding of a disease defining point mutation in hairy cell leukemia. Furthermore, high resolution melting with confirmatory Sanger sequencing are useful methods that can be employed in routine diagnostic laboratories to detect BRAF mutations in patients with hairy cell leukemia and related lymphoproliferative disorders.

摘要

已证实,多毛细胞白血病与 BRAF V600E 突变密切相关。我们采用高分辨率熔解分析和确证性 Sanger 测序法,对 51 例多毛细胞白血病患者的 59 份未富集的存档骨髓抽吸物和外周血样本进行了筛查。在 38 份样本(来自 36 例患者)中检测到 BRAF V600E 突变。在所有疾病受累样本中均检测到技术检测灵敏度上限以上的 BRAF V600E 突变。34 份来自其他血液系统恶性肿瘤的样本中,BRAF 突变均为阴性。在一例脾边缘区淋巴瘤患者中检测到 BRAF K601E 突变。我们的数据支持近期在多毛细胞白血病中发现的疾病定义性点突变。此外,高分辨率熔解和确证性 Sanger 测序是有用的方法,可在常规诊断实验室中用于检测多毛细胞白血病和相关淋巴增生性疾病患者的 BRAF 突变。
